Teenage Pedelec Operator Experiences Slight Injuries in Accident

On a Saturday afternoon, a traffic accident involving a motorized bicycle (e-bike) occurred on Ostwennemarstraße in Hamm, Germany. The exact time of the accident was around 3 pm.

The incident took place at the junction with a side street, where a 16-year-old e-bike rider was riding northbound. The teenager fell off his e-bike while attempting to avoid a collision. As a result, the rider sustained injuries.

Fortunately, the injuries sustained by the 16-year-old were minor. An ambulance was promptly dispatched to the scene and transported the teenager to a hospital for treatment.
